Designed with 1.4mm 60° angled jaws, this vascular clamp offers superior access to blood vessels located within confined or anatomically challenging operative fields. The 60-degree jaw angle enables surgeons to approach vascular structures from an optimal position, improving visualization and facilitating precise placement during delicate cardiovascular procedures. The fine jaw profile is particularly suitable for handling small arteries, veins, and vascular grafts while preserving surrounding tissues.
The DeBakey-style atraumatic serrations distribute clamping pressure evenly across the vessel surface, helping minimize unnecessary trauma while maintaining a secure grip. This design is especially beneficial during vascular reconstruction and anastomosis, where preserving vessel integrity is critical to successful surgical outcomes.

Product Specifications Table
|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Product Name | DeBakey Castaneda Clamp |
| Instrument Type | Cardiovascular Vascular Clamp |
| Jaw Size | 1.4mm |
| Jaw Configuration | 60° Angled Jaws |
| Handle Design | Curved Handle |
| Pattern | DeBakey Castaneda |
| Application | Cardiovascular, Vascular & Pediatric Surgery |
| Function | Temporary Vessel Occlusion and Vascular Control |
| Material | Surgical-Grade Stainless Steel |
| Design | Precision Atraumatic Vascular Clamp |
| Finish | Satin/Polished Surgical Finish |
| Sterilization | Autoclave and Standard Sterilization Compatible |
